This is what my bud Mark sent me :D.  I am no wizard at techie stuff so I need some hand holding please.  Does this look right?  I plugged the Dragon Fly DAC into the PC USB port.  I hooked a RCA cable with two male plugs into the Juicy Music Blueberry AUX 1.  The other end of the cable (1/8") into the mic (audio out) of the Dragon Fly.  I have good sound while streaming standard Spotify.

 

I am not using the cable shown as there are no jacks like that on the BB.  Should I be?  Don't know what I would hook the other end up to! 

 

A giant thanks to Mark for his generosity ( he would not accept payment) and to anyone that can verify my hook up.
